• При регистрации в компьютерной системе каждому пользователю выдаётся идентификатор, состоящий из 10 символов , первый и последний из которых - одна из 18 букв , а остальные -цифры ( допускается использование 10 десятичных цифр ). Каждый такой идентификатор в компьютерной программе записывается минимально возможным и одинаковым целым количеством байт ( при этом используют посимвольное кодирование; все цифры кодируются одинаковым и минимально возможным количеством бит , все буквы также кодируются одинаковым и минимально возможным количеством бит). Определите объем памяти в байтах , отводимой этой программой для записи 25 паролей
    .

Ответы 1

  • Всего в 1 пароле 10 символов1  2  3  4  5  6  7  8  9 10_  _  _  _  _  _  _  _  _  _ 1. Вес 1 символа в битах.1 и 10 символы - одни из 18 букв.2^x>=18x=5 битт - вес 1 символа и вес 10 символаЦифр может быть 10, следовательно,2^x>=10x=4 бит - вес 2,3,4,5,6,7,8,9 символов2. Вес пароля в битах 2 буквенных символа по 5 бит каждый, следовательно, 2*5=10 бит - первый и последний символы вместе8 цифровых символов по 4 бита каждый8*4=32 бита - общий все цифровых символовобщий вес пароля= 32+10=42 бит3. Вес пароля в байтах1 байт=8 бит42<=8*xx= 6  байт - вес пароля в байтах4. Вопрос задачи.для 25 паролей будет 25*6=150 байтответ: 150
  • Добавить свой ответ

Войти через Google

или

Забыли пароль?

У меня нет аккаунта, я хочу Зарегистрироваться

How much to ban the user?
1 hour 1 day 100 years